In our first session together, here's what you can expect

During our first session, you can expect a welcoming, supportive, and judgment-free environment where we will begin getting to know each other. We will discuss what brought you to therapy, your current concerns, personal strengths, and any goals you would like to work toward. I will ask questions about your mental health history, relationships, support systems, and other areas of your life to gain a better understanding of your needs. Together, we will identify priorities for treatment and develop a plan that feels meaningful and achievable for you. My goal is to ensure that you feel heard, respected, and comfortable as we begin working toward your wellness and recovery goals.
